What Does P245B Mean?
The EGR cooler bypass valve is not responding as expected to commands from the ECM. The valve position or flow does not match the commanded state, indicating a mechanical or electrical control issue.
Common Causes
35%
EGR cooler bypass valve stuck or binding mechanically
25%
Carbon buildup restricting valve movement
20%
Faulty valve position sensor or feedback circuit
15%
Wiring issues to bypass valve actuator
5%
Failed valve actuator motor
Diagnostic Steps
1
Step 1: Monitor EGR cooler bypass valve commanded position vs actual position using live data
2
Step 2: Perform actuator test using scan tool to verify valve responds to commands
3
Step 3: Inspect valve for carbon buildup and mechanical binding
4
Step 4: Check wiring and connectors to valve actuator for damage, corrosion, or loose connections
5
Step 5: Test valve actuator motor resistance and operation with power supply if mechanical operation is free
